Fife Kicks Off Spring Season

Karli Fife competed as an individual at the Iowa Central Community College Invitational at Fort Dodge Country Club. The competitive field featured a mix of NAIA, D3, and JUCO schools. Fife tallied scores of 105 - 101 over the weekend, which landed her a 45th finish.  

 

"I saw a lot of good things out of Karli this weekend. She had some mental fatigue which is to be expected after a long winter break. As she continues to dial in her yardages and get back into the grind of competitive golf, her scores will steadily improve. Karli has a bright future as a Laker and I'm anxiously waiting for that breakthrough tournament for her. As she continues to prove to herself that she's good enough to compete at the college level, we will see her really start to climb these leaderboards," said Coach Myers. "Karli has a ton of talent that we haven't even tapped into yet. I think she's going to shock herself over the next 1.5 years at what she's able to accomplish."
